Details & Features

A Bucket Elevator is a machine that moves goods from a lower place to a higher place. It can be used to move grains, seeds, fruits, vegetables, and other small items from a lower place to a higher place. It uses many small buckets attached to a belt or chain. These buckets pick up the material, lift it, and then drop it at the top. In farms, factories, warehouses, and markets, carrying goods by hand from low to high takes time and a lot of effort. A bucket elevator makes this work very fast and easy. It works all day without getting tired. It can carry heavy loads and large quantities without needing many workers. The machine has a strong body made from steel. It is made to work in all weather and last for many years. It is safe to use, and it keeps the goods from getting damaged during lifting. Farmers use it to move grains from ground level to storage silos. In fruit and vegetable units, it is used to take goods from cleaning machines to grading machines. In industries, it helps in moving small parts or raw materials to the next process.
